The quote "Growing old is compulsory, growing up is optional" encapsulates a profound perspective on life and aging, emphasizing the distinction between physical maturity and emotional or psychological development. Let's explore its meaning and implications:


1. **Physical vs. Emotional Maturity:**

   This quote draws a clear distinction between aging physically (growing old) and maturing emotionally or mentally (growing up). While everyone inevitably ages and experiences the passage of time, emotional maturity and personal growth are choices that individuals can actively pursue throughout their lives. It suggests that while aging is a natural process, maturity and wisdom are not guaranteed solely by the passage of time but require conscious effort and introspection.


2. **Embracing Inner Child:**

   "Growing up is optional" encourages individuals to maintain a sense of playfulness, curiosity, and wonder throughout their lives, regardless of chronological age. It challenges the notion that adulthood should be characterized solely by seriousness or conformity, advocating instead for a balance between responsibility and spontaneity. By embracing our inner child and nurturing creativity, imagination, and joy, we can cultivate a more fulfilling and vibrant life.


3. **Resisting Social Expectations:**

   The quote also suggests a rejection of societal norms or expectations that dictate how individuals should behave or think based on their age. It encourages authenticity and self-expression, allowing individuals to define their own paths and priorities rather than conforming to external pressures. By resisting ageist stereotypes and embracing individuality, people can live more authentically and meaningfully.


4. **Continual Learning and Growth:**

   Embracing the idea that "growing up is optional" promotes a lifelong commitment to learning, personal growth, and self-improvement. It encourages individuals to seek new experiences, challenge themselves, and adapt to change with resilience and openness. By cultivating a growth mindset and pursuing opportunities for learning and development, individuals can continue to evolve and thrive at any stage of life.


5. **Choosing Fulfillment and Happiness:**

   Ultimately, this quote encourages individuals to prioritize fulfillment, happiness, and well-being in their lives. It suggests that true maturity is not measured by external achievements or societal milestones but by the ability to live authentically, pursue passions, and maintain meaningful connections with others. By making conscious choices that align with our values and aspirations, we can create a life that is rich in purpose, joy, and fulfillment.


In conclusion, "Growing old is compulsory, growing up is optional" invites us to rethink our attitudes towards aging and maturity. It encourages us to embrace the freedom to choose how we approach life's challenges and opportunities, emphasizing the importance of maintaining a youthful spirit, curiosity, and resilience throughout our journey.  Earth is the third planet from the Sun and the only known place in the universe that supports life. It formed about 4.5 billion years ago and has a unique combination of conditions that make life possible, including the presence of liquid water, a suitable atmosphere, and a stable climate. About 71% of Earth’s surface is covered by water, mostly in oceans, while the remaining 29% consists of continents and islands. The planet’s atmosphere is mainly composed of nitrogen and oxygen, which are essential for most living organisms. Earth also has a protective magnetic field that shields it from harmful solar radiation. The planet rotates on its axis, causing day and night, and revolves around the Sun, resulting in the changing seasons. Earth is home to a vast diversity of life forms, ranging from tiny microorganisms to complex plants and animals.
